Transaction f58e16cb61b0711a8559cb95d8888f75e6dc11cba261e5c83fc04086623b06a7
1 Input
2 Outputs
- f58e16cb61b0711a8559cb95d8888f75e6dc11cba261e5c83fc04086623b06a7:0
- f58e16cb61b0711a8559cb95d8888f75e6dc11cba261e5c83fc04086623b06a7:1
value 15000000
address 1AWhJuX46FZV8evCTdoJa25MmC87uEFGFs
value 2820154080
address 12N6XsZBwsbYD6eGHXDS9thZDmpdyT1hK9